Jeon refers into a category of savoury pancake-like fritters, which could include an array of meat, seafood and vegetable elements. 1 preferred assortment is pajeon, which happens to be a savoury Korean pancake that characteristics spring onions/scallions as one of the important elements.
Skewers that Merge A variety of seasoned meats and veggies also are a favourite. Some thing like sanjeok brings together slices of beef with veggies, which can be then grilled. You'll find all sorts of versions with distinctive elements, with some skewers together with rice cakes.

Beer is usually paired with dry snacks, and it?�s easy to see why. Liquor is thought to reinforce the taste of salty and fatty foods; and in turn, these sorts of foods also enhance the style of beer. Using these points in mind, there?�s no wonder that a great number of Koreans like to pair beer with dry foods.
Rice wine pairs with spicy kimchi, gochujang-primarily based stir-fries, bulgogi, and crispy pork belly to call several. Very like the rest of the environment, anju for beer involves greasy favorites like Korean fried rooster, corn cheese, and stir-fried rice cakes, as well as dried jerkies and nuts. Jumaks are no longer inns but continue being the term utilised to explain standard Korean bars serving legendary Korean anju. Beer pubs are referred to as Hof Properties and provide a combination of Western and Korean anju.}
